I installed the Trial Office 2007 Home and Student (all default install) over
top of Office 2003 .... and I find I can no longer (as I did in 2003) send the document via e-Mail from Word (using Outlook Express). The icons for e-Mail are grayed out. I am pretty sure Office 2003 supported mailing via Outlook Express. I have no need nor do I want to buy Outlook 2007, it is far to complicated and powerful for any use I could possibly have. Anyway to get Office 2007 Home and Student to use OE as a "send to" program. Thanks. |

REPLYING TO MY OWN QUESTION.
I found that I had to edit the registry per article located he http://support.microsoft.com/kb/9187...=11377&sid=139 METHOD #2 in that article worked for me. ---------------------------------------------------- "kda" wrote: I installed the Trial Office 2007 Home and Student (all default install) over top of Office 2003 .... and I find I can no longer (as I did in 2003) send the document via e-Mail from Word (using Outlook Express).
